ATT&CK relationship table

Techniques used

This mirrors the MITRE pattern of making group, software, campaign, and technique relationships scannable. Relationship notes come from mirrored ATT&CK relationship text when available.

19 rows
DomainIDNameRelationship / procedure
EnterpriseT1016System Network Configuration Discovery

BLUELIGHT can collect IP information from the victim’s machine.[1]

EnterpriseT1560.003Archive via Custom MethodSub-technique

BLUELIGHT has encoded data into a binary blob using XOR.[1]

EnterpriseT1033System Owner/User Discovery

BLUELIGHT can collect the username on a compromised host.[1]

EnterpriseT1082System Information Discovery

BLUELIGHT has collected the computer name and OS version from victim machines.[1]

EnterpriseT1105Ingress Tool Transfer

BLUELIGHT can download additional files onto the host.[1]

EnterpriseT1027.013Encrypted/Encoded FileSub-technique

BLUELIGHT has a XOR-encoded payload.[1]

EnterpriseT1041Exfiltration Over C2 Channel

BLUELIGHT has exfiltrated data over its C2 channel.[1]

EnterpriseT1518.001Security Software DiscoverySub-technique

BLUELIGHT can collect a list of anti-virus products installed on a machine.[1]

EnterpriseT1070.004File DeletionSub-technique

BLUELIGHT can uninstall itself.[1]

EnterpriseT1102.002Bidirectional CommunicationSub-technique

BLUELIGHT can use different cloud providers for its C2.[1]

EnterpriseT1539Steal Web Session Cookie

BLUELIGHT can harvest cookies from Internet Explorer, Edge, Chrome, and Naver Whale browsers.[1]

EnterpriseT1555.003Credentials from Web BrowsersSub-technique

BLUELIGHT can collect passwords stored in web browers, including Internet Explorer, Edge, Chrome, and Naver Whale.[1]

EnterpriseT1057Process Discovery

BLUELIGHT can collect process filenames and SID authority level.[1]

EnterpriseT1560Archive Collected Data

BLUELIGHT can zip files before exfiltration.[1]

EnterpriseT1497.001System ChecksSub-technique

BLUELIGHT can check to see if the infected machine has VM tools running.[1]

EnterpriseT1083File and Directory Discovery

BLUELIGHT can enumerate files and collect associated metadata.[1]

EnterpriseT1071.001Web ProtocolsSub-technique

BLUELIGHT can use HTTP/S for C2 using the Microsoft Graph API.[1]

EnterpriseT1124System Time Discovery

BLUELIGHT can collect the local time on a compromised host.[1]

EnterpriseT1113Screen Capture

BLUELIGHT has captured a screenshot of the display every 30 seconds for the first 5 minutes after initiating a C2 loop, and then once every five minutes thereafter.[1]

Groups, software, and campaigns

GroupEnterprise

G0067: APT37

APT37 is a North Korean state-sponsored cyber espionage group that has been active since at least 2012. The group has targeted victims primarily in South Korea, but also in Japan, Vietnam, Russia, Nepal, China, India, Romania, Kuwait, and other parts of the Middle East. APT37 has also been linked to the following campaigns between 2016-2018: Operation Daybreak, Operation Erebus, Golden Time, Evil New Year, Are you Happy?, FreeMilk, North Korean Human Rights, and Evil New Year 2018.[1][2][3]

North Korean group definitions are known to have significant overlap, and some security researchers report all North Korean state-sponsored cyber activity under the name Lazarus Group instead of tracking clusters or subgroups.
